I’ve learned that free doesn’t always mean legal. Instead of searching for random PDFs, I focus on legitimate sources. Project Gutenberg is perfect for classics, while Open Library lets you borrow modern books digitally. I also love Scribd’s free trial, which gives access to tons of novels temporarily.

For fan-translated works, like certain Japanese light novels, I check if the translation group has official partnerships. Some publishers, like J-Novel Club, offer free previews. Webnovel platforms like Wuxiaworld also have legal free chapters.

I avoid shady sites because they often compromise device security. Libraries are underrated—they’re a goldmine for free, legal reads. If a book isn’t available, I save up or wait for sales. Authors deserve fair compensation for their work, after all.

Finding free pdf novels can be tricky, but I’ve discovered a few ethical ways over the years. Project Gutenberg is my go-to for classics—everything from Jane Austen to Sherlock Holmes is available there. For contemporary works, I use library services like Hoopla or OverDrive, which let you borrow e-books legally with a library card. Some universities also share free academic texts and public domain books on their digital libraries.

If you’re into niche genres, like light novels or indie works, authors often share free PDFs on their personal blogs or Patreon as samples. Websites like ManyBooks aggregate free titles, though you must double-check copyright status. I avoid sketchy PDF repositories because they’re often riddled with malware or violate copyright laws. Instead, I follow publishers’ newsletters—they sometimes give away free books during promotions.

For manga or comics, platforms like Manga Plus or Viz offer official free chapters. It’s worth waiting for legal releases rather than risking unsafe downloads. Supporting creators ensures more great stories in the future.

I love diving into novels, but I also understand the struggle of finding free PDFs legally. Instead of risking shady sites, I rely on platforms like Project Gutenberg or Open Library, which offer thousands of classic novels for free because they’re in the public domain. For newer titles, I check if the author or publisher has shared free chapters or editions on their official websites. Some authors, like Brandon Sanderson, even release free content occasionally. Libraries also provide free digital loans through apps like Libby. It’s safer and supports creators more than random PDF hunts.

If you’re into fan translations or web novels, sites like Wattpad or Royal Road host free original stories. Just remember that pirated downloads hurt authors, so I always prioritize legal routes first.
